From 387540b660fd51affff1afd5ee57ed1107527e06 Mon Sep 17 00:00:00 2001 From: Alex Rock Ancelet Date: Wed, 27 Jan 2016 11:50:18 +0100 Subject: [PATCH 1/2] Fix issue in profiler when having errors in forms --- .../Resources/views/Collector/form.html.twig | 4 +++- 1 file changed, 3 insertions(+), 1 deletion(-) diff --git a/src/Symfony/Bundle/WebProfilerBundle/Resources/views/Collector/form.html.twig b/src/Symfony/Bundle/WebProfilerBundle/Resources/views/Collector/form.html.twig index 0608c71a446e0..b2c53b75dd018 100644 --- a/src/Symfony/Bundle/WebProfilerBundle/Resources/views/Collector/form.html.twig +++ b/src/Symfony/Bundle/WebProfilerBundle/Resources/views/Collector/form.html.twig @@ -156,13 +156,15 @@ color: #999; } .badge-error { - float: right; background: #B0413E; color: #FFF; padding: 1px 4px; font-size: 10px; font-weight: bold; vertical-align: middle; + position: absolute; + top: 7px; + right: 7px; } .errors h3 { color: #B0413E; From 6b162ef6749d72183b4cd257fd6dd2b8b7932629 Mon Sep 17 00:00:00 2001 From: Alex Rock Ancelet Date: Wed, 10 Feb 2016 00:59:16 +0100 Subject: [PATCH 2/2] Rollback to float, bring the error tag before the links --- .../Resources/views/Collector/form.html.twig | 12 +++++------- 1 file changed, 5 insertions(+), 7 deletions(-) diff --git a/src/Symfony/Bundle/WebProfilerBundle/Resources/views/Collector/form.html.twig b/src/Symfony/Bundle/WebProfilerBundle/Resources/views/Collector/form.html.twig index b2c53b75dd018..eb87a8fa8abb1 100644 --- a/src/Symfony/Bundle/WebProfilerBundle/Resources/views/Collector/form.html.twig +++ b/src/Symfony/Bundle/WebProfilerBundle/Resources/views/Collector/form.html.twig @@ -156,15 +156,13 @@ color: #999; } .badge-error { + float: right; background: #B0413E; color: #FFF; padding: 1px 4px; font-size: 10px; font-weight: bold; vertical-align: middle; - position: absolute; - top: 7px; - right: 7px; } .errors h3 { color: #B0413E; @@ -429,6 +427,10 @@ {% import _self as tree %}
  • + {% if data.errors is defined and data.errors|length > 0 %} +
    {{ data.errors|length }}
    + {% endif %} + {% if data.children is not empty %} {% else %} @@ -436,10 +438,6 @@ {% endif %} {{ name|default('(no name)') }} {% if data.type_class is defined and data.type is defined %}[{{ data.type|split('\\')|last }}]{% endif %} - - {% if data.errors is defined and data.errors|length > 0 %} -
    {{ data.errors|length }}
    - {% endif %}
    {% if data.children is not empty %}